Junior livestock show goat exhibitor results
Hayden Smith with the Hawkins FFA showed the grand champion goat at the video version of the Wood County Junior Livestock Show.
The show was transitioned to a video model after it could not be held as usual April 2-4.
Reserve champion honors went to Karsyn Johnson of the Hawkins FFA.
Showmanship awards went to Madison Poole of Winnsboro FFA (senior) and Daniel Kernes of Quitman FFA (junior).
